Tony ‘Birds Streets’ perch takes in stellar city views

Share

Crisp and clean-lined exteriors and interiors unite this reimagined contemporary home in Hollywood Hills West. Glass walls fold away to connect the light and bright indoor and outdoor living areas. Views stretch from the ocean to downtown Los Angeles.

Address: 1517 Oriole Lane, Los Angeles 90069

Price: $8.5 million (or $32,000 a month for lease, furnished)

Built: 1953

Lot size: 6,921 square feet

House size: 3,500 square feet, three bedrooms, three full bathrooms, powder room

Features: Living room fireplace, formal dining area, kitchen island bar, stainless-steel appliances, breakfast nook, office, wide-plank wood flooring, infinity pool, barbecue center with built-in seating, outdoor dining area, two-car attached garage

About the area: The median sale price for single-family homes in the 90069 ZIP Code in December was $2.32 million based on 15 sales, according to CoreLogic. That was a 5.3% decrease compared with the same month the previous year.
